Building Around What You’re Already Great At
Most successful businesses begin with a founder who has built something exceptional.
That might be a service, a product, or a unique way of doing things, but it’s the thing that delivers real value to clients.
That core offering is often where the founder is strongest. It’s where the insight, expertise, and differentiation live. But as the business grows, the founder’s role starts to shift.
You’re pulled away from the work you love; client conversations, product refinement, service delivery, and drawn into everything else: logistics, team issues, internal structures, hiring, goal setting, management, culture, growth planning.
These operational layers must be strong if the business is going to scale.
And that’s the tension. The better your product or service becomes, the more demand you create, and the more your time is absorbed by the very things that pull you away from what made the business great in the first place.
My role as a coach is to help you build the business around that core thing you’re great at, so you can spend more time doing the work that matters, while the rest of the machine starts to function with more clarity, purpose, and strength.

My Strategic Coaching Approach
My coaching is rooted in business strategy, but not in a vacuum.
It’s shaped by the day-to-day reality of leading a small or growing team, wearing multiple hats, and feeling the pressure to make the right decisions quickly. We focus on what’s actually happening in your business right now and build from there.
Whether you’re stuck on a hiring decision, unsure how to structure a team, or dealing with unclear priorities, we’ll work through it in a way that fits your leadership style and your business.
Here’s how we work.
1. Initial Strategy Session
We start with a practical deep dive into your business.
We’ll look at what’s working, what’s not, and where your time and energy are going. This business assessment session helps us find the pressure points quickly, so we’re not guessing.
From there, we set clear focus areas that will guide our work together going forward.
We map the critical issues that need attention and set the groundwork for everything that follows.
2. Goal Mapping
Once we understand your challenges, we start defining the outcomes that matter most to you.
That could be freeing up your time, financial growth, restructuring your team, or creating streamlined operations and internal processes to make things run smoother.
We’ll define goals to guide our work, but we’ll keep them flexible so they stay useful as your business evolves. We map the most impactful objectives and break them down into manageable milestones, so your progress isn’t left to chance.
3. Regular coaching sessions
After the initial strategy work, we set a regular cadence for coaching sessions that fits your pace and goals.
That might be we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ly, depending on what’s most effective for your context.
These sessions focus on the work we’ve agreed matters most. I’ll introduce tools, training, and relevant frameworks as needed.
When it’s useful, we can bring your wider team into the process to build alignment and momentum.
4. Accountability Support
We stay connected between sessions.
That might mean reviewing a hiring plan, helping you prep for a key conversation, or nudging you to revisit something we agreed was important.
This is really about making sure the work we do together doesn’t sit in a notebook. It needs to turn into progress, so between sessions, I help you stay on track with what matters most.
You shouldn’t feel that anything urgent needs to wait until our next session, so I’m always on hand to connect and work on something offline between our scheduled sessions.
5. Ongoing Adjustments
As you make progress and your business changes, we adjust the coaching to match.
New challenges will come up. Priorities will shift. People might leave or join your team.
We won’t stick to a rigid path. The coaching evolves so it stays relevant to what you’re facing week-to-week and month-to-month.
Growth isn’t linear, and your plan shouldn’t be either.
The coaching evolves with you. We’ll revisit priorities, update goals, and course-correct when needed, so the support always meets the moment you’re in.

What’s the difference between coaching and consulting?
Business coaching is a collaborative, exploratory process that helps you clarify your thinking, uncover blind spots, and strengthen your leadership.
It’s not about delivering a fixed playbook. Consulting often involves assessing a situation and recommending a solution. I do both, but the coaching creates the foundation. We build clarity first, then design smart, relevant action together.
